Pedal control refers to the mechanism or system that allows a user to operate and manage the pedals of a vehicle or machine, typically to regulate speed, power, or braking.

In the world of technology and innovation, one of the most fascinating developments has been in the field of robotics and automation. As industries evolve, the need for precise control mechanisms becomes increasingly important. One such mechanism that stands out is padal control, which refers to the method of controlling a machine or vehicle using pedals. This system allows for nuanced and responsive manipulation of speed and direction, making it essential for various applications, from vehicles to industrial machinery.The concept of padal control can be traced back to early mechanical devices, where foot pedals were used to operate machinery. Over time, this idea has been refined and integrated into modern technology. In vehicles, for instance, the accelerator and brake pedals allow drivers to control their speed with remarkable precision. This is crucial not only for safety but also for efficiency, especially in complex driving situations like navigating through traffic or making sharp turns.Moreover, padal control is not limited to just vehicles. In the realm of music, pedal controls are vital for musicians who play instruments like pianos and organs. The use of foot pedals can alter sound dynamics, allowing for expressive performances. This duality of function—both in mechanical and artistic domains—highlights the versatility of padal control as a concept.In the industrial sector, padal control systems are employed in heavy machinery, such as forklifts and excavators. Operators use foot pedals to manage the speed and movement of these machines, enabling them to carry out tasks with precision. This is particularly important in environments where safety is paramount, as it allows for quick adjustments to be made in response to changing conditions.The advantages of padal control extend beyond mere functionality. The ergonomic design of pedal systems means that operators can maintain a more comfortable posture while working, reducing fatigue during long hours of operation. This is an essential consideration in industries where workers are required to perform repetitive tasks for extended periods.As we look towards the future, the integration of technology with padal control systems is likely to become even more sophisticated. Innovations such as sensors and artificial intelligence could enhance the responsiveness of pedal controls, allowing for even greater precision and adaptability. For example, imagine a vehicle that adjusts its acceleration based on real-time traffic conditions, all controlled through intuitive pedal movements.In conclusion, padal control represents a fundamental aspect of both mechanical and artistic practices. Its application spans across various fields, demonstrating its importance in enhancing performance, safety, and user experience. As technology continues to advance, the evolution of padal control will undoubtedly play a critical role in shaping the future of automation and control systems. Understanding and mastering this concept will be essential for anyone looking to engage with the next generation of technological innovations.
